对于希望在自己的环境中部署 Mushroom 的用户,提供了自动化安装指南。本指南详细介绍了 Mushroom 的安装步骤,包括环境设置和配置。
要安装 Mushroom,必须满足以下环境要求:
操作系统:Ubuntu 18.04 或更高版本
内存:最小 8GB 内存
CPU:4 个或更多内核的 CPU
存储:至少 100GB 可用硬盘空间
1. 使用以下命令克隆 Mushroom 存储库:
```bash
git clone https://github.com/mushroom-labs/mushroom.git
```
2. 导航到下载的目录,并安装 Mushroom:
```bash
cd mushroom
python3 setup.py install
```
3. 激活 Mushroom 虚拟环境:
```bash
source activate mushroom-env
```
1. 创建一个配置文件,其中包含 Mushroom 的配置参数:
```bash
mkdir mushroom-config
vi mushroom-config/config.yml
```
2. 配置文件示例:
```yaml
Mushroom 配置文件
mushroom:
database:
uri: postgresql://user:password@host:port/database_name
rabbitmq:
host: localhost
port: 5672
username: guest
password: guest
```
3. 启动 Mushroom 服务:
```bash
mushroom-worker run
mushroom-api run
```
该指南提供了一个自动化脚本,可以简化 Mushroom 的安装和配置过程。脚本包含以下功能:
检查环境要求
下载 Mushroom 存储库
安装 Mushroom
创建配置文件
启动 Mushroom 服务
1. 如果安装过程出现错误,请检查环境是否满足要求。
2. 确保已激活 Mushroom 虚拟环境。
3. 检查配置文件是否包含正确的配置参数。
4. 检查 Mushroom 服务是否正在运行。
对于需要更高级配置的用户,该指南还提供了以下选项:
自定义蘑菇数据库模式
配置多实例蘑菇部署
监控 mushroom 性能
安装 Mushroom 后,用户可以探索其功能并将其集成到他们的工作流程中。该指南提供了有关使用 Mushroom 进行数据管理、数据可视化和流程自动化的资源。
Mushroom 提供了一系列功能,包括:
数据管理:创建和管理数据源、转换数据、加载数据到仓库中。
数据可视化:使用拖放式界面创建交互式仪表板和报告。
流程自动化:自动化数据导入、转换和分析过程。
Mushroom 集成了一个生态系统,其中包括:
连接器:连接到各种数据源,例如关系数据库、云存储和 API。
操作:执行数据处理任务,例如数据清理、转换和聚合。
可视化:生成交互式可视化,例如图表、表格和地图。
Mushroom 文档
Mushroom 社区论坛
Mushroom GitHub 存储库